Point standings (top 10) following the 72nd annual Cornwell Quality Tools NHRA U.S. Nationals at Lucas Oil Indianapolis Raceway Park, the 14th of 20 events in the NHRA Mission Foods Drag Racing Series –

Doug Kilitta US NATS

Top Fuel – 

1. Doug Kalitta, 1,352; 2. Shawn Langdon, 1,344; 3. Leah Pruett, 1,095; 4. Tony Stewart, 900; 5. Antron Brown, 893; 6. Maddi Gordon, 863; 7. Josh Hart, 754; 8. Billy Torrence, 710; 9. Justin Ashley, 691; 10. Clay Millican, 589.

Matt Hagan US NATS

Funny Car –

1. Matt Hagan, 1,083; 2. Ron Capps, 1,056; 3. Jack Beckman, 1,043; 4. Jordan Vandergriff, 1,014; 5. J.R. Todd, 966; 6. Austin Prock, 890; 7. Alexis DeJoria, 822; 8. Chad Green, 807; 9. Daniel Wilkerson, 695; 10. Spencer Hyde, 667.

Dallas Glenn US NATS

Pro Stock –

1. Dallas Glenn, 1,235; 2. Greg Anderson, 1,230; 3. Greg Stanfield, 1,025; 4. Matt Hartford, 991; 5. Erica Enders, 842; 6. Matt Latino, 798; 7. Jeg Coughlin, 787; 8. Aaron Stanfield, 783; 9.

Cody Anderson, 657; 10. Troy Coughlin Jr., 645.

Richard Gadson US NATS

Pro Stock Motorcycle – 

1. Richard Gadson, 795; 2. Matt Smith, 726; 3. Gaige Herrera, 723; 4. Angie Smith, 715; 5. John Hall, 461; 6. Ryan Oehler, 426; 7. Chase Van Sant, 416; 8. Jianna Evaristo, 407; 9. Clayton Howey, 393; 10. Steve Johnson, 358.
